Effective load planning software plays a critical role in logistics and transportation efficiency. Key features that define a solid system include route optimization to reduce fuel costs and delivery time, weight distribution tools to ensure vehicle safety and compliance, and real-time tracking to monitor shipments and make quick adjustments when needed. These capabilities help companies stay agile while cutting down on operational costs.
Many also look for integration with existing ERP or TMS systems, user-friendly dashboards, and predictive analytics that help plan smarter over time. As delivery expectations grow more demanding, having software that offers flexibility, automation, and detailed reporting becomes essential.

The debate between micro and macro influencers really comes down to goals and audience connection. Macro influencers often bring huge reach and visibility, making them great for brand awareness campaigns. But their engagement rates can be lower, and their audiences are usually more general.
Micro influencers, on the other hand, tend to have stronger relationships with their followers, often focusing on specific niches. That means higher engagement and a more trusted voice—ideal for brands looking to build credibility and drive targeted actions.
So which delivers better ROI? It depends on your campaign. Micro influencers may offer better returns in terms of engagement and conversion, especially if your product fits a niche. Has anyone here had more success with one over the other?
Meeting the growing demand for same-day or next-day delivery has become one of the biggest pressures in modern logistics. Customers now expect speed, accuracy, and real-time tracking as standard, often influenced by big players like Amazon setting a high bar. However, the reality on the operational side is far more complex.
Companies struggle with unpredictable traffic conditions, high delivery costs, limited workforce availability, and managing delivery density in both urban and rural areas. Technology can help optimize routes and improve coordination, but scaling consistently while maintaining profit margins remains a major challenge. AI and machine learning are playing a huge role in transforming how businesses approach route optimization. By using predictive analytics and analyzing historical traffic, weather, and delivery data, companies can now make smarter decisions in real-time. Machine learning models continuously learn from new data, which helps fine-tune routes to avoid delays, reduce fuel costs, and improve delivery times.
Whether it's logistics, public transportation, or ride-sharing services, these technologies are helping companies operate more efficiently while improving customer satisfaction. As AI becomes more accessible, route planning is getting faster, more accurate, and responsive to on-the-ground changes.

AI and IoT are becoming game changers in the world of fleet management. With the integration of smart sensors and real-time data tracking, companies can now monitor vehicle performance, driver behavior, and route efficiency like never before. Predictive analytics powered by AI helps forecast maintenance needs before breakdowns occur, significantly reducing downtime and repair costs.
IoT devices also enable automation in routing and scheduling, allowing fleets to adapt quickly to traffic changes or delivery delays. This means faster deliveries, better fuel efficiency, and increased overall safety. As these technologies continue to evolve, we're likely to see even more streamlined and sustainable operations in the logistics sector.
